Cheat grass. Bromus tectorum, the weed pest of the day.  I have pulled bushels and it it still way ahead of me.  Now is the time to get it under control, before the seeds mature.  It is an annual grass that spreads by seed, so to control it, you must stop the seed.  It is an alien species, coming from the steppes of Russia and has naturalized here very successfully.  It is a problem as it competes with the native grasses and it is aggresive.  When the seed ripens it is sharp, it sticks in your socks and shoes.  It gets in dogs ears, (I have spent hundreds of dollars at the vet) between their paws and in their noses. 

It is very lush this season, it loves the spring rains.  I have never seen it so tall and robust.  I have one area here it is so tall and thick that it actually  lodged.  Get out there now and pull that cheat grass.
